Trip to Vaishno Devi...

Reached back today morning at 5.00 a.m. Trip was as wonderful..did a nite journey and got down at Pathankot…then took another train and reached Jammu..looking at the city I found that it looks like a Volcano…I mean sleeping all the times and suddenly bursting out…anyways part of life…Reached Katra…and checked in a hotel. Started for the temple at 7.30 in the nite when it was dark. I thought of walking and some accompanied me while others took the horse to reach half way. 14 kms is the length of the stretch on the hill with a steep journey. First 3 kms were steeper than rest. After 3kms I realized that walking in a shoe was helping me only in getting blisters and shoebites on my feet. So decided to remove the shoes and walk barefoot. Rest 11 kms barefoot…there were many ppl barefoot..so that wasn’t unique…I decided not to wear a jacket or pullover to make it a tough one for myself..and at 12.30a.m I reached the temple with others…Cold icy breeze was enough to give me the idea of the toughness of the journey…After the Darshanam went to Bhairav temple(without visiting this temple the journey is not considered as complete) but we took a horse as we were short of time. We covered the whole journey in 12 hrs time…
